Our overall score for Melbourn is 48/100, built from 9 categories. Healthcare is where Melbourn most outperforms the national norm: 35/100 against a median of 18/100 across UK towns. That makes it the 2nd highest-scoring of the 19 places in the SG8 postcode district.

On healthcare specifically, Melbourn sits 14 points above the SG8 district figure of 21/100. Safety (92) sits at 80/100 or above. Below 30/100: schools (16) and transport (22). The same breakdown for the wider area is on the SG8 postcode district.

Frequently asked questions

Is Melbourn a nice place to live?

Melbourn has some challenges compared to many UK areas. Our liveability score for Melbourn is 48/100, placing it among a below-average areas in the UK across nine categories: safety, schools, healthcare, environment, transport, broadband, lifestyle, economic health, and bills.

How safe is Melbourn?

Melbourn is a relatively safe area to live. Our safety score is 92/100. There were 237 crimes recorded in the area over the past 12 months.

What are the best schools in Melbourn?

Among the top-rated schools in Melbourn is Melbourn Primary School, rated Good by Ofsted. There are 3 rated schools in Melbourn in total.

What are house prices like in Melbourn?

The current median house price in Melbourn is £402,500, around 41% above the England and Wales average. By property type: detached £575,000, semi-detached £371,250. Over the past five years, prices have fallen by around 10%. There were 32 sales recorded in the past 12 months.
